Lena Oberdorf is a 24-year-old football player who plays as a defensive midfielder for Bayern München, born on 19 de diciembre de 2001, who is right-footed. Lena Oberdorf's career has also included time at VfL Wolfsburg and SGS Essen.

On the international stage, Lena Oberdorf has represented Germany, Germany Under 20, Germany Under 19, and Germany Under 17.

Throughout their career, Lena Oberdorf has won 10 titles: DFB Pokal Frauen (2024/2025), Frauen Bundesliga (2024/2025), and Supercup der Frauen (2025/2026, 2024/2025) with Bayern München, DFB Pokal Frauen (2023/2024, 2022/2023, 2021/2022, 2020/2021) and Frauen Bundesliga (2021/2022) with VfL Wolfsburg, and UEFA U17 Championship Women (2017 Czech Republic) with Germany Under 17.
